What are some typical challenges faced by senior business intelligence BI developers when integrating data from multiple sources?

Senior Business Intelligence BI Developers often encounter challenges such as handling inconsistent data formats, ensuring data quality, and resolving discrepancies between source systems. Integrating data from multiple platforms requires robust 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) processes and close collaboration with data owners and business stakeholders. Additionally, developers must optimize data models for performance and scalability, especially when dealing with large datasets, while maintaining clear documentation and version control.

What is a senior business intelligence BI developer?

A Senior Business Intelligence (BI) Developer is an experienced professional who designs, develops, and maintains data analytics and reporting solutions for organizations. They work with large datasets, create dashboards, and implement data models to help businesses make data-driven decisions. Senior BI Developers typically collaborate with stakeholders to understand business requirements and translate them into technical solutions using BI tools and technologies. Their expertise often includes data warehousing, 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) processes, and advanced data visualization. They also mentor junior team members and ensure the accuracy, reliability, and security of business intelligence systems.

Senior Business Intelligence Developer

AprilAire

Madison, WI • On-site

Full-time

Posted 17 days ago


Job description

Overview
The Senior Business Intelligence Developer combines report development, user training and support, and data modeling expertise to help transform business data into actionable insights. In addition to performing hands-on technical work, you will be a go-to representative of the BI team for the rest of the organization. The ideal candidate will be proficient technically in Power BI (including data modeling, DAX, and report development) while also being comfortable working closely with business stakeholders to deliver high-quality analytics solutions.
Hybrid role at our downtown Corporate location or Sun Prairie location
Responsibilities
  • Develop, maintain, and optimize Power BI reporting for multiple business areas.
  • Partner with other departments (product, sales, marketing, R&D) understanding their usage and turning their requests into dashboards
  • Build and maintain semantic models and DAX measures in Power BI.
  • Work with business users to understand requirements for new requests.
  • Provide training, support, and guidance to end users and user-developers to maximize adoption and understanding of BI tools.
  • Collaborate with the BI team to ensure data accuracy, consistency, and accessibility.
  • Identify opportunities to improve analytics processes, tools, and standards.

Qualifications
  • Strong experience in Power BI, including report development, Power Query, DAX formulas, and managing user environments in the Power BI Service.
  • SQL experience strongly preferred
  • Experience providing end-user training and support in a BI environment.
  • Ability to create a dashboard with a focus on continuous improvement based on customer and business needs
  • Effective change management and project management skills
  • Ability to solicit feedback to understand user needs, display attentive listening skills, and a customer service mindset
  • Solid understanding of data modeling, relational databases, and data warehousing concepts.
  • Strong ability and initiative to learn and solve new problems using new technology or techniques.
  • Bachelor's deg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Analytics,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
